La face cachée de la viande dives into the underbelly of meat production with a raw, unfiltered lens. The documentary unpacks the stark realities of animal farming, revealing the darker sides that often go unseen by the public. The atmosphere is heavy, almost oppressive at times, but that’s what gives it its weight. The pacing isn’t frantic; it unfolds at a rhythm that allows you to really absorb the stark imagery and testimonies presented. While the director remains unknown, the film’s distinctive approach to practical effects and visceral storytelling leaves a mark. It forces viewers to confront the ethical dilemmas tied to food consumption. An experience rather than just a watch.
